Invention Grant
- Patent Title: Dynamic cache configuration using separate read and write caches
- Patent Title (中): 动态缓存配置使用单独的读写高速缓存
-
Application No.: US12903834Application Date: 2010-10-13
-
Publication No.: US08504774B2Publication Date: 2013-08-06
- Inventor: Charbel Khawand , Scott A. Fudally
- Applicant: Charbel Khawand , Scott A. Fudally
- Applicant Address: US WA Redmond
- Assignee: Microsoft Corporation
- Current Assignee: Microsoft Corporation
- Current Assignee Address: US WA Redmond
- Agency: Klarquist Sparkman, LLP
- Main IPC: G06F13/00
- IPC: G06F13/00

Abstract:
Data from storage devices is stored in a read cache, having a read cache size, and a write cache, having a write cache size. The read cache and the write cache are separate caches. Cache configuration of the read cache and the write cache are automatically and dynamically adjusted based, at least in part, upon cache performance parameters. Cache performance parameters include one or more of preference scores, frequency of read and write operations, read and write performance of a storage device, localization information, and contiguous read and write performance. Dynamic cache configuration includes one or more of adjusting read cache size and/or write cache size and adjusting read cache block size and/or write cache block size.
Public/Granted literature
- US20120096225A1 DYNAMIC CACHE CONFIGURATION USING SEPARATE READ AND WRITE CACHES Public/Granted day:2012-04-19
Information query